About the RoleAt Paradigm, some of our hardest and most important engineering problems begin with a customer.
Deployed Engineers work directly with our customers to identify high-value workflows, understand their data and systems, and turn those workflows into production AI agents on Paradigm.
You might spend one week working with an investment firm to automate diligence across thousands of companies and the next building a workflow that connects a customer's CRM, internal documents, and external data sources to continuously surface new opportunities.
You'll operate at the intersection of engineering, product, and our customers. You'll prototype solutions, build integrations, configure and deploy agents, debug failures, and help customers move from an initial use case to organization-wide adoption.
This is not a traditional solutions engineering role. We expect Deployed Engineers to build. You'll have the autonomy to solve customer problems directly and the responsibility to bring what you learn back into the core product.
